#ifndef _MACHINE_LIMITS_H_
#define _MACHINE_LIMITS_H_

#define __CHAR_BIT  8   /* number of bits in a char */
//#define MB_LEN_MAX  32    /* no multibyte characters */

#define __SCHAR_MIN (-128) /* max value for a signed char */
#define __SCHAR_MAX 127    /* min value for a signed char */

#define __UCHAR_MAX 255   /* max value for an unsigned char */
//#define CHAR_MAX  0x7f    /* max value for a char */
//#define CHAR_MIN  (-0x7f-1) /* min value for a char */

#define __USHRT_MAX 0xffffU   /* max value for an unsigned short */
#define __SHRT_MAX  0x7fff    /* max value for a short */
#define __SHRT_MIN  (-0x7fff-1) /* min value for a short */

#define __UINT_MAX  0xffffffffU /* max value for an unsigned int */
#define __INT_MAX   0x7fffffff  /* max value for an int */
#define __INT_MIN         (-0x7fffffff-1) /* min value for an int */

//#define __ULONG_MAX 0xffffffffffffffffUL  /* max value for an unsigned long */
//#define __LONG_MAX  0x7fffffffffffffffL /* max value for a long */
//#define __LONG_MIN  (-0x7fffffffffffffffL-1)  /* min value for a long */
#define __ULONG_MAX __UINT_MAX  /* max value for an unsigned long */
#define __LONG_MAX  __INT_MAX /* max value for a long */
#define __LONG_MIN  __INT_MIN  /* min value for a long */


#define SSIZE_MAX LONG_MAX  /* max value for a ssize_t */

#define __ULLONG_MAX  0xffffffffffffffffULL /* max unsigned long long */
#define __LLONG_MAX 0x7fffffffffffffffLL  /* max signed long long */
#define __LLONG_MIN (-0x7fffffffffffffffLL-1) /* min signed long long */

#define SIZE_T_MAX  __ULLONG_MAX /* max value for a size_t */

/* GCC requires that quad constants be written as expressions. */
#define UQUAD_MAX ((u_quad_t)0-1) /* max value for a uquad_t */
          /* max value for a quad_t */
#define QUAD_MAX  ((quad_t)(UQUAD_MAX >> 1))
#define QUAD_MIN  (-QUAD_MAX-1) /* min value for a quad_t */


#define LONG_BIT  32
#define WORD_BIT  32

/* Intel extensions to <limits.h> for UEFI */
#define __SHORT_BIT     16
#define __WCHAR_BIT     16
#define __INT_BIT       32
#define __LONG_BIT      32    /* Compiler dependent */
#define __LONG_LONG_BIT 64
#define __POINTER_BIT   64

#endif /* _MACHINE_LIMITS_H_ */
